THIS IS A Sources Sought Notice ONLY. The U.S. Government desires to procure industrial additive manufacturing equipment, installation, configuration, and manufacturer‑led training at Fort Hood, TX. The requirement includes brand name or similar systems meeting or exceeding the capabilities of: Two (2) Professional 3D scanners Functional & Technical Characteristics: Portable handheld design — Must be a lightweight, handheld 3D scanning device suitable for field and shop floor use. Blue laser capture — Must utilize blue laser or equivalent high resolution optical technology with at least 23 laser lines. Metrology grade accuracy — Must achieve accuracy up to 0.030 mm with volumetric accuracy of 0.020 mm + 0.060 mm/m. Flexible working distance — Must support a working distance of approximately 200–750 mm. Wide object size range — Must be capable of scanning parts from 0.05 m to 4 m in size. High speed data capture — Must support rapid acquisition suitable for complex geometries and irregular surfaces. Real time tracking — Must maintain stable tracking without external targets or markers unless required for specific applications. Standard file outputs — Must export STL, .OBJ, PLY, STEP, or equivalent formats compatible with downstream CAD/AM workflows. Software integration — Must integrate with provided processing software for mesh cleanup, alignment, and export. Environmental tolerance — Must operate reliably in typical indoor lighting and shop floor conditions. The Contractor shall deliver, install, configure, calibrate, and verify full operational capability, and provide manufacturer‑led training sufficient to certify Soldiers in safe and effective operation, except for those items identified as Government‑furnished, on a small business set-aside basis, provided 2 or more qualified small businesses respond to this sources sought notice with information sufficient to support a set-aside.
